Narrative:The pilot was conducting an aerial clean-up run over a crop of tomatoes, which involved flying under a main set of powerlines and a branch line. As he was flying under the branch line, he began to pull up and then realised the aircraft was in the path of a main line. He attempted to go under the line, but the aircraft contacted the line with the rudder, part of which was severed. The pilot then conducted a forced landing in an area which was found to be unsuitable for landing, resulting in further damage to the aircraft.
